英文摘要
Rising rates of overweight and obesity of both children and adults in the UK is of major concern. Current government policy has primarily focused on reducing childhood rates of overweight and obesity by ensuring healthy school meals and building physical activity into daily life. However, parent‘s eating habits, physical activity patterns, and body composition will influence their children‘s behaviour. Determining the role that parent‘s plays in impacting their children‘s behaviour will be important to create effective policy to promote the health of current and future generations. This research uses economic techniques to establish the relationship between parents and children‘s behaviour concerning the areas of eating habits, physical activity, and body composition. Differences by parental gender and the affect of single parent households will be examined. The availability of supermarkets and fast food chains on eating behaviour and weight of family members will also be addressed. Finally, the effectiveness of current government policy will be analysed. Results will increase the understanding of family interactions and behaviour regarding eating habits, physical activity, and body composition as well as determining the effectiveness of current policy to reduce childhood obesity.
